POWERTRAIN CONTROL MODULE
Ground Circuits
Turn ignition off. Disconnect PCM 104-pin connector. PCM is located on right rear of engine compartment.
Using DVOM, check for continuity between chassis ground and PCM harness connector terminals No. 3, 25,
51, 76 and 103. See Fig. 1 . If continuity exists, see POWER CIRCUITS . If continuity does not exist, repair
open in affected ground circuit. See ENGINE PERFORMANCE in SYSTEM WIRING DIAGRAMS article in
ELECTRICAL.

NOTE:
Testing individual components does not isolate short or open circuits. Perform
all voltage tests with a Digital Volt-Ohmmeter (DVOM) with a minimum 10-
megohm input impedance, unless stated otherwise in test procedure. Use
ohmmeter to isolate shorted or open wiring harness. For identification of
circuits and terminals referenced in test procedures, see ENGINE
PERFORMANCE in SYSTEM WIRING DIAGRAMS article in ELECTRICAL.
